Main features :
- Moving Averages : as shown by the wave ribbon (the gradient colored areas opacity is correlated with the distance from the Nth xMA to the last xMA)
- Trend Strenght : as shown by the blue/orange/red triangle shape plotted at the bottom of the chart
- Moving Average Cross Signal : as shown by the labels green LabelUp and red LabelDown
Also it is designed to be easily customizeable as the settings allow to:
- Chose different smoothing method for the 10 xMAs plotted
- Manually setup the length of each xMA or simply select a predefined list of convenient length
- Choose different MA length not only for crossover but also for crossunder
Trend Strenght explanation :
- When all the "fast xMA" are above "slow xMA" there is an opaque Blue UpTriangle plotted at bottom (bull trend)
- As more "fast xMA" fall/cross below "slow xMA", the Blue UpTriangle will start fading to a translucid orange UpTriangle
- As even more "fast xMA" fall/cross below "slow xMA", a Red DownTriangle is plotted insteand and become more and more opaque as more MA fall below others
